No, fornication is not required to have children. Most of the world's children come as a result of sex between a married couple. Fornication is sex outside of marriage, not within marriage. "Marriage is honorable among all, and the bed undefiled; but fornicators and adulterers God will judge" (Hebrews 13:4). It is not a sin for a wife to have sex with her husband because no laws are broken.
